Description

4-Piperidinol, 1-(1-Oxobutyl)- (9Ci) is a versatile piperidine derivative, a key heterocyclic building block in advanced organic synthesis. Its value lies in its functionalized structure, which provides a crucial scaffold for constructing complex molecules with specific pharmacological or agrochemical activities. This compound is primarily needed by research and development chemists in the pharmaceutical and agrochemical industries for creating novel active ingredients and intermediates.

Basic Information

Product Name 4-Piperidinol, 1-(1-Oxobutyl)- (9Ci)
CAS No. 202647-18-5
Molecular Formula C9H17NO2
Molecular Weight 171.24 g/mol
Synonyms 1-Butanoyl-4-piperidinol; 1-Butyryl-4-hydroxypiperidine; 4-Hydroxy-1-butyrylpiperidine; N-Butyryl-4-piperidinol; 1-(1-Oxobutyl)-4-piperidinol; 4-Piperidinol, 1-butyryl-; 1-Butanoyl-4-hydroxy-piperidine

Storage

Preserve in a tightly closed container, protected from light. Due to its hygroscopic (moisture-sensitive) nature, the container must be kept in a cool, dry place. Recommended storage temperature is between 15°C and 25°C. Ensure the storage area is well-ventilated and away from incompatible materials.
